Migration Guide from Twilio to Agora: iOS Edition
Blog post from Agora
This guide provides detailed steps for replacing Twilio's delegate design pattern with Agora's singleton design pattern in an iOS application. The process involves creating an easily accessible variable, replacing the Twilio video pod and import statements, removing four delegates, initializing an instance of the Agora singleton, enabling video, configuring the canvas or video, joining a channel, and handling disconnection and other features. By following these steps, developers can adopt Agora's voice, video, and live-broadcasting software for their applications, leveraging its Software Defined Real-Time Network (SD-RTN™) infrastructure.
